Starting from 2026, FPT Play officially holds the broadcasting rights for the Premier League in Vietnam, with the contract lasting until the end of the 2030/31 season. Therefore, all matches of the 25th round of the Premier League tonight will be broadcast live by this provider.

The 25th round of the Premier League today (7/2) promises to be thrilling as it holds crucial significance for the title race, top 4 spots, and relegation battles, especially as the season enters a decisive phase.
The highlight tonight is the clash between MU and Tottenham. The Red Devils are in good form with three consecutive wins, closing in on the top 4 and needing a victory to maintain momentum, while Tottenham has sharply declined, falling into the lower half of the table. Home advantage and consistent performance give MU a slight edge.
The match between Arsenal and Sunderland is also highly anticipated. The Gunners are determined to win the title and aim for a victory. Arsenal leads the table and cannot afford to slip against a lower-ranked opponent. With superior attacking power and stability, the Gunners are expected to secure all three points.
The Wolves vs Chelsea game is a tough test for Chelsea in their pursuit of a top 4 spot. Wolves sit at the bottom but often play fiercely at home, likely causing difficulties.
In the mid-table group, Fulham hosts Everton in an evenly matched game. Fulham is solid at home, while Everton still relies heavily on counter-attacking defense. A draw is a likely outcome.
Finally, Bournemouth faces Aston Villa, while Newcastle meets Brentford. Villa and Brentford are both fiercely competing in the upper group, forcing them to aim for three points to stay in the intense race this season.
